The governance gap behind many retail ERP failures
Many retail ERP programs struggle because governance is defined too narrowly. Steering committees review status, PMOs track milestones, and system integrators manage configuration. Yet the most material risks often sit outside those controls: unresolved process ownership, duplicate master data, conflicting KPI definitions, local exceptions that undermine standardization, and training models that do not reflect store and distribution realities.
In practice, enterprise retailers need implementation lifecycle management that governs four dimensions simultaneously: process decisions, data decisions, deployment sequencing, and adoption outcomes. If one dimension is under-managed, the others degrade. A technically sound deployment can still fail operationally if item, vendor, location, and chart-of-accounts structures are not governed with discipline.
This is especially relevant in retail, where high transaction volumes and seasonal peaks leave little tolerance for process ambiguity. Governance must therefore be designed as an operational control system, not a reporting ritual.

A governance model for retail process standardization and data discipline
An effective retail ERP governance model should separate strategic authority from operational execution while keeping both tightly connected. Executive sponsors define transformation outcomes, but domain councils should own process and data decisions at a level close enough to operations to be practical. This structure reduces escalation noise and accelerates decision quality.
| Governance layer | Primary mandate | Retail focus |
|---|---|---|
| Executive steering committee | Approve scope, funding, risk posture, and enterprise policy decisions | Balance transformation ambition with continuity during peak trading periods |
| Process and data design authority | Own cross-functional standards and exception approvals | Align merchandising, supply chain, finance, and store operations workflows |
| Program PMO and deployment office | Manage milestones, dependencies, readiness, and reporting | Coordinate waves across stores, DCs, regions, and support teams |
| Business readiness and adoption office | Drive training, communications, role readiness, and hypercare planning | Prepare store managers, planners, buyers, and back-office teams for new ways of working |
The design authority is often the missing layer. In retail modernization programs, it acts as the control point for workflow standardization and business process harmonization. It should adjudicate where the enterprise must standardize, where controlled variation is justified, and where legacy practices should be retired.
For example, a multi-brand retailer may allow local assortment planning differences by banner while enforcing a common item master, supplier onboarding model, inventory status taxonomy, and financial posting structure. Governance maturity comes from making these distinctions explicit rather than allowing them to emerge through configuration drift.
Cloud ERP migration governance in the retail environment
Cloud ERP migration changes the governance equation because retailers move from heavily customized legacy environments to more standardized platforms with faster release cycles. This creates long-term modernization benefits, but only if the organization is prepared to govern process fit, integration architecture, release management, and data conversion with discipline.
A common retail scenario illustrates the point. A specialty retailer migrates finance, procurement, and inventory control to a cloud ERP while retaining a separate POS and e-commerce stack. If integration governance is weak, promotion timing, return flows, and inventory reservations can become inconsistent across channels. The ERP may be functioning as designed, yet enterprise operations remain disconnected.
Cloud migration governance should therefore include release impact reviews, interface ownership, test data controls, environment management, and clear policies for extension versus customization. Retailers that fail to govern these areas often recreate technical debt in the cloud under the label of agility.
Implementation scenarios that show why governance must be operationally grounded
Consider a global fashion retailer deploying a new ERP across merchandising, sourcing, finance, and regional distribution. The initial design assumes a single global product hierarchy. During deployment, regional teams request local category structures to preserve historical reporting. Without a formal data governance process, the program accepts multiple variants. Six months later, margin analysis and allocation planning become inconsistent across regions, undermining executive confidence in the new platform.
In a second scenario, a grocery retailer launches ERP-driven replenishment and supplier settlement in phases. The technology deployment is on schedule, but store operations training is compressed to protect labor budgets. Department managers continue using offline ordering habits, receiving exceptions are not resolved correctly, and invoice discrepancies increase. The issue is not software quality; it is a failure in organizational adoption architecture and operational readiness planning.
In both cases, governance should have enforced decision rights, readiness thresholds, and measurable adoption criteria before wave expansion. Retail ERP rollout governance must be anchored in business execution, not only in project administration.
How onboarding and adoption strategy determine implementation outcomes
Retail ERP programs often underinvest in onboarding because leaders assume intuitive interfaces will reduce training needs. That assumption is risky. Even when user experience improves, the underlying process model usually changes significantly. Buyers may follow new approval paths, store managers may execute different inventory adjustments, and finance teams may close periods using redesigned controls and reconciliations.
An enterprise adoption strategy should map role-based change impacts, define proficiency expectations, and sequence enablement by deployment wave. Training should be tied to real transaction scenarios such as purchase order amendments, inter-store transfers, markdown approvals, returns reconciliation, and stock count adjustments. This is how onboarding becomes part of operational modernization rather than a late-stage communication task.
| Adoption control | Why it matters | Retail indicator |
|---|---|---|
| Role-based readiness scoring | Confirms users can execute critical transactions before go-live | Store, DC, merchandising, and finance teams meet minimum proficiency thresholds |
| Super-user network | Creates local support capacity during rollout and hypercare | Regional champions resolve process questions without overloading central teams |
| Transaction simulation | Tests behavior in realistic operating conditions | Users complete receiving, transfer, pricing, and close tasks with acceptable accuracy |
| Adoption analytics | Measures whether process change is actually taking hold | Exception rates, manual workarounds, and help tickets decline after each wave |

Balancing standardization, flexibility, and operational resilience
Retailers should not interpret governance as rigid centralization. The objective is controlled standardization: enough consistency to support enterprise reporting, automation, and scalability, while preserving justified local variation where customer, regulatory, or channel requirements differ. Governance provides the mechanism for making those tradeoffs transparently.
Operational resilience must remain central throughout the ERP modernization lifecycle. Cutover plans should account for store opening routines, warehouse throughput, promotion calendars, supplier communication, and financial close windows. Hypercare should prioritize high-volume transaction paths and exception management, not only technical incident response. This is where transformation governance protects revenue continuity.
